エントリーの編集
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
rswagを使ったテストファーストなAPI開発のフローを確認する - Qiita
記事へのコメント0件
- 注目コメント
- 新着コメント
このエントリーにコメントしてみましょう。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
rswagを使ったテストファーストなAPI開発のフローを確認する - Qiita
今回のゴール チーム開発に必要な API 仕様をコードと乖離せずメンテナンスしていくフローの検討です。 ... 今回のゴール チーム開発に必要な API 仕様をコードと乖離せずメンテナンスしていくフローの検討です。 rails で API を作る場合、controller にメソッドを定義してルーティング設定するだけで簡単にできますが、 チーム開発等ではフロントエンジニアにソースを確認してもらうのは現実的ではないため、その API の仕様をドキュメントで共有するかと思います。 方法としては swagger.yaml を書いて swagger ui で確認するというのがあります。 ただし swagger の書き方は若干慣れが必要ですし、API が修正されると実態とずれてしまうリスクがあります。 そこで rswag という rails で spec をかけばそれをもとに swagger.yaml を生成してくれる gem を使えば問題が解決するのではと考えました。 ここではその手順を記録していきます。